Maths
We started on the topic 'Mass'. Pupils learnt how to read the mass of objects in kilogrammes and grammes. They estimated the mass of various objects (Maths textbook, our handbook, pencil case, etc) and checked the actual mass using a kitchen scale.
(What you can do at home: Read pages 33-34 of the Maths textbook and do Question 6 on page 35. You can also ask your mom for permission to use the kitchen scale to weigh some objects and try reading the mass.)
